The effect is generated by "system_plugin_bg.rco". You can disable them, and you can change the background, but no alternate effects as-of-yet. The code is embedded deep inside the encrypted file, and we are not sure quite what it is. It may be a transparent animation, or perhaps just code.

If we could change it, (Requiring decryption, alteration, re-encryption), it would be something very similar. After all, what other effects could you possibly apply? Most effects would probably require a 3D engine, or an impossibly complex series of files and code. Even then, you've got the problem of the size limitations (Probably impossible to bypass).
So, on the whole, a new background effect seems fairly far-fetched as the situation lies. Sorry!
